Hotel Booking Hacks: Tips for Securing Money on Your Stay

Planning a trip and looking to nab the best deal on your hotel? Look no further! These tips will help you unearth hidden savings and ensure a budget-friendly stay.

First, be adaptable with your travel dates. Traveling during the off-season or on weekdays can often lead to significantly lower prices. Also, consider staying just outside the downtown core. You might find a delightful hotel in a quieter neighborhood for a steal of the price.

Don't be afraid to negotiate with hotels directly. Sometimes, you can secure a better rate by calling the hotel directly.

Lastly, always examine prices from different booking websites and membership programs. You never know where you'll find the best deal!

  • Utilize price comparison websites to compare rates across various hotels and platforms.
  • Sign up for hotel loyalty programs to earn points and unlock exclusive discounts.
  • Look for package deals that combine accommodation with other travel services like flights or car rentals.

By following these simple tips, you can effortlessly save money on your next hotel booking.

From Guest to Houseguest: Setting Boundaries and Expectations

Navigating the shift from guest to houseguest can sometimes be a little difficult. It's important to remember that while staying with someone is usually a wonderful opportunity for connection and fun, it also requires clear communication and shared expectations.

Before you pack your bags, have an open and honest conversation with your host about things like how long you'll be staying. Be sure to discuss household expectations too. For example, are there specific times for meals or quiet hours? Is it okay to use their items, and if so, what needs to be cleaned up after being used?

It's also important hotel booking to set boundaries for yourself. Think about things like how much space you need, and don't be afraid to express your needs with your host. A little bit of planning and communication can go a long way in ensuring that everyone has a comfortable and enjoyable stay.

Remember, staying with friends or family should be a positive experience. By being respectful, open to negotiation, and communicating clearly, you can make the most of your time together.

Grasping Your Lease Agreement

Securing a rental property is an exciting step, but it's crucial to completely grasp your rights and responsibilities. The lease agreement serves as the foundation of your tenancy, outlining key terms that govern your relationship with your landlord. Thoroughly reviewing this document before signing is essential to stay away from any future misunderstandings or disputes.

  • Get to know yourself with the duration of your lease term and any renewal options.
  • Understand the method for paying rent, including due dates and acceptable payment methods.
  • Review the clause regarding maintenance responsibilities.

Being aware of your tenant rights empowers you to navigate your tenancy smoothly. If you encounter any concerns or problems, don't hesitate to reach out to legal resources or tenant advocacy groups for clarification.
